交通大數(shù)據(jù)解決方案 數(shù)據(jù)庫開發(fā)與管理的核心策略與實(shí)踐
隨著城市化進(jìn)程的加速和智能交通系統(tǒng)的不斷發(fā)展,交通大數(shù)據(jù)已成為優(yōu)化城市管理、提升出行效率的關(guān)鍵資源。交通大數(shù)據(jù)解決方案的核心在于高效、可靠的數(shù)據(jù)庫開發(fā)與管理,這不僅涉及海量數(shù)據(jù)的存儲與處理,更關(guān)乎實(shí)時(shí)分析、智能決策與系統(tǒng)穩(wěn)定性。本文將探討交通大數(shù)據(jù)背景下數(shù)據(jù)庫開發(fā)與管理的核心策略與實(shí)踐路徑。
一、交通大數(shù)據(jù)的特點(diǎn)與數(shù)據(jù)庫挑戰(zhàn)
交通大數(shù)據(jù)通常具備“4V”特征:數(shù)據(jù)體量巨大(Volume)、來源多樣且實(shí)時(shí)性強(qiáng)(Velocity)、類型復(fù)雜(Variety)以及價(jià)值密度低但潛在價(jià)值高(Value)。例如,交通流量傳感器、GPS軌跡、視頻監(jiān)控、移動支付記錄等數(shù)據(jù)源持續(xù)產(chǎn)生TB甚至PB級數(shù)據(jù)。這對數(shù)據(jù)庫系統(tǒng)提出了高并發(fā)讀寫、低延遲響應(yīng)、彈性擴(kuò)展與多模態(tài)數(shù)據(jù)支持等嚴(yán)峻挑戰(zhàn)。
二、數(shù)據(jù)庫開發(fā)的核心策略
- 分層架構(gòu)設(shè)計(jì):采用分層數(shù)據(jù)架構(gòu),將原始數(shù)據(jù)、清洗后數(shù)據(jù)、聚合數(shù)據(jù)與應(yīng)用數(shù)據(jù)分離,提升處理效率。例如,使用分布式存儲系統(tǒng)(如HDFS)存儲原始日志,通過數(shù)據(jù)管道(如Kafka+Spark)進(jìn)行實(shí)時(shí)流處理,并將結(jié)果存入高性能數(shù)據(jù)庫(如ClickHouse或時(shí)序數(shù)據(jù)庫)供分析查詢。
- 多模數(shù)據(jù)庫融合:交通數(shù)據(jù)包含結(jié)構(gòu)化(如車輛登記信息)、半結(jié)構(gòu)化(如JSON格式的傳感器數(shù)據(jù))和非結(jié)構(gòu)化數(shù)據(jù)(如監(jiān)控視頻)。開發(fā)中需結(jié)合關(guān)系型數(shù)據(jù)庫(如PostgreSQL)、NoSQL數(shù)據(jù)庫(如MongoDB存儲軌跡數(shù)據(jù))與時(shí)序數(shù)據(jù)庫(如InfluxDB處理傳感器流),通過數(shù)據(jù)湖或數(shù)據(jù)中臺實(shí)現(xiàn)統(tǒng)一訪問。
- 實(shí)時(shí)處理能力:針對交通管控、事故預(yù)警等場景,需開發(fā)低延遲數(shù)據(jù)處理模塊。利用內(nèi)存數(shù)據(jù)庫(如Redis)緩存熱點(diǎn)數(shù)據(jù),并采用流計(jì)算框架(如Flink)實(shí)現(xiàn)實(shí)時(shí)流量分析與異常檢測。
三、數(shù)據(jù)庫管理的關(guān)鍵實(shí)踐
- 可擴(kuò)展性與容災(zāi):交通數(shù)據(jù)增長迅速,數(shù)據(jù)庫需支持水平擴(kuò)展。通過分片(Sharding)技術(shù)分布數(shù)據(jù)負(fù)載,并設(shè)置多副本與跨地域備份,確保系統(tǒng)在硬件故障或網(wǎng)絡(luò)中斷時(shí)仍能持續(xù)服務(wù)。云原生數(shù)據(jù)庫(如AWS Aurora或阿里云PolarDB)提供了自動擴(kuò)縮容與高可用保障。
- 數(shù)據(jù)安全與合規(guī):交通數(shù)據(jù)常包含個(gè)人隱私(如出行軌跡),管理上需加密存儲、實(shí)施訪問控制(RBAC)與審計(jì)日志。符合GDPR等法規(guī)要求,對敏感數(shù)據(jù)脫敏處理,并通過數(shù)據(jù)生命周期策略定期歸檔或清理歷史數(shù)據(jù)。
- 性能監(jiān)控與優(yōu)化:建立全方位的監(jiān)控體系,跟蹤查詢延遲、吞吐量、存儲使用率等指標(biāo)。利用索引優(yōu)化、查詢重寫與緩存策略提升性能;定期進(jìn)行數(shù)據(jù)壓縮與分區(qū)維護(hù),減少存儲開銷。AI驅(qū)動的自治數(shù)據(jù)庫(如Oracle Autonomous Database)可自動執(zhí)行部分優(yōu)化任務(wù)。
四、案例與未來展望
某智慧城市項(xiàng)目通過搭建混合數(shù)據(jù)庫平臺,整合了交通信號數(shù)據(jù)、公交車GPS與市民卡支付記錄,實(shí)現(xiàn)了實(shí)時(shí)擁堵分析與公交調(diào)度優(yōu)化。隨著5G與車聯(lián)網(wǎng)普及,邊緣數(shù)據(jù)庫與云邊協(xié)同管理將成為趨勢,同時(shí)圖數(shù)據(jù)庫(如Neo4j)將更廣泛用于交通網(wǎng)絡(luò)關(guān)系分析。數(shù)據(jù)庫開發(fā)與管理也需融入數(shù)據(jù)治理框架,確保數(shù)據(jù)質(zhì)量與一致性,最終支撐起智能、綠色、安全的交通體系。
交通大數(shù)據(jù)解決方案的成功,離不開穩(wěn)健且靈活的數(shù)據(jù)庫開發(fā)與管理。通過結(jié)合分層架構(gòu)、多模存儲、實(shí)時(shí)處理與自動化運(yùn)維,我們不僅能應(yīng)對當(dāng)前的數(shù)據(jù)挑戰(zhàn),更能為未來智慧交通的演進(jìn)奠定堅(jiān)實(shí)基礎(chǔ)。
如若轉(zhuǎn)載,請注明出處:http://m.zspcc.com/product/8.html
更新時(shí)間:2026-05-23 23:25:49